A 3.1-to-9.6GHz 12-Band WiMedia UWB Transceiver in 0.13um CMOS

This paper presents a low-power UWB transceiver covering 3.1 to 9.6GHz of RF spectrum and complying with WiMedia specifications. Transceiver has a single-chain wideband front-end with 7GHz bandwidth and a 12-band fast-hopping direct frequency synthesizer. Built in general purpose 0.13um CMOS, the chip consumes 330mW and 280mW peak power in RX and TX mode, respectively.
